How Our Team Handles Bedroom Water Removal
Our process is designed to get your bedroom back to normal as quickly and efficiently as possible. We understand that every minute counts with water damage, and we’re committed to getting the job done right the first time. We’ll work tirelessly to restore your bedroom to its original condition.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team will arrive at your doorstep within 60 minutes to assess the damage and develop a customized plan to get your bedroom back to normal.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and find out the best course of action. We’ll give you a clear understanding of what to expect and when to expect it.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our technicians will use powerful pumps and vacuums to extract water from your bedroom, including carpets, padding, and walls. We’ll also use specialized equipment to remove standing water and dry out the area. We’ll work quickly to reduce further damage and get your bedroom dry.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ture from the air and speed up the drying process. Our technicians will also use specialized equipment to dry out walls, ceilings, and floors. We’ll work to prevent further damage and get your bedroom back to normal.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Our team will thoroughly clean and sanitize your bedroom, including carpets, upholstery, and walls. We’ll use specialized equipment to remove any remaining moisture and prevent further mold growth. We’ll leave your bedroom smelling fresh and clean and feeling safe.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Touch-ups
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that your bedroom is completely dry and free of any remaining moisture. We’ll make any necessary touch-ups to ensure that your bedroom is back to normal. We’ll stand behind our work and guarantee your satisfaction.

Bedroom Water Removal Cost In Jasper, GA
The cost of bedroom water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Jasper, GA. We’ll work with you to develop a customized plan and provide a clear estimate of the costs involved.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ed |
| Final inspection and touch-ups | $500 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ed |
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ment, and we offer free estimates to help you understand the costs involved. We’ll work with you to develop a customized plan and provide a clear estimate of the costs involved.
